Definition Magazine deem our Cinescope optics “Fit for the future”

Check out our brand new article in this months edition of Definition Magazine. Definition Magazine have considered our Cinescope Optics lenses “Fit for the future” due to our flag ship product, the Leica R lens,. These lenses are rehoused and designed by True Lens Services ‘TLS’, due to our lenses being ‘full frame’ vista vision along with the influx of Red Weapon 8K and vista-vison sensors, soon to flood the industry.

To find out more. Visit: